### MeasureMate release — signing step

Before publishing the MeasureMate recipe-scaling calculator, run the full unit suite and confirm the scaling ratios match the golden fixtures. Tag the commit, build the bundle, and sign it before upload; unsigned bundles are rejected by the distribution gate. Sign the artifact using the following deploy key.

deploy key for hawef-yadup: bky19_kVT4YunTZZSTyhFQQoK

## Account Recovery — Order Cutoff (Crumbline)

Crumbline bakery orders lock at 14:00 local the day before pickup. If a customer is locked out post-cutoff, do NOT edit orders directly. Restore account access first, then escalate cutoff exceptions to the Dough Desk queue. Recovery requires identity check plus the vault unlock. Open the Crumbline admin vault and enter the recovery passphrase that appears directly below this line.

vault phrase of tajeg-tageg = pelix-druix-holius-briael-zorwyn-frawyn-fraox-norok-drueth-aldiel

Future maintainers: the scaling test matrix fails most often on fractional-unit conversions, specifically when a recipe scales below one serving. The rounding helper truncates rather than rounds in that path, and the golden files were generated before that behavior was noticed, so a "fix" will break the suite until the fixtures are regenerated. Always regenerate fixtures and the rounding change in the same commit, and note the regeneration in the changelog. Tag the run with the build token below.

session token of kageg-tahop = htk14_af3c1ccccb7dcf

FeedCheck is our podcast feed validator; it runs hourly against every show registered in the Quillcast directory. Setup is straightforward: clone the repo, install dependencies, and copy the sample env file. Set the fetch concurrency and the directory base path first. The last required entry is the directory access secret, which goes on the line below.

env line for fafof-fahag: LEDGER_TOKEN5=f8790

**Vendor note: Inkmill markdown pipeline**

Rendering for Parchway docs is outsourced to Inkmill under an annual contract, renewing each March. They handle sanitization and PDF export; we own the upload queue. SLA: 4-hour response on rendering failures. Escalate only after two failed retries. Their support desk is reachable at the address below.

billing contact of hahaf-baguf = zorael.tammir.jorius@sivrelhq.internal